The modelling of a spring-time flood streams on the Vyatka River to the forecast extreme situations

  • 1. Computing Centre named A.A. Dorodnitsyn FRC IC RAS, Moscow (Russian Federation)
  • 2. Vyatka State University, Kirov (Russian Federation)

Description

There are presented results of modelling of a spring-time flood run evolving on a river floodplain. The model is used to forecast contamination transfer processes during spring floods running on Kirovo-Chepetsk floodplain of Vyatka River. The model verification was made with satellite photoshots of the flood propagation area and with monitoring data for contamination concentrations obtained by ecological services both of Kirovo-Chepetsk chemical plant and of Kirov region's administration. The digital implementation of the model can allow to simulate action of various defensive hydrotechnical structures that might be designed and to evaluate their influence on the redirection of the flood streams.
